The Future of Electronics: Bendable Circuit Boards

In the ever-shrinking globe of electronic devices, where miniaturization preponderates, a brand-new type of circuit board has actually arised-- the adaptable published circuit card (versatile PCB), likewise referred to as a flex circuit or bendable circuit board. Unlike its rigid relative, the common FR4 PCB, the versatile PCB boasts outstanding pliability, enabling it to comply with distinct shapes and match limited areas. This game-changing characteristic makes them optimal for a wide range of applications, from sleek wearable technology to space-saving medical devices.

Another noteworthy advancement is the rigid-flex PCB, a hybrid construction incorporating the most effective features of both inflexible and versatile PCBs. This kind of PCB consists of multiple layers of adaptable circuit substratums connected to one or more inflexible boards. The assimilation of stiff and flexible materials permits the development of more facility and functional styles, which are important in high-performance applications where space, weight, and reliability are essential variables. Rigid-flex circuit card are typically used in army and aerospace applications, medical devices, and customer electronics. They provide the mechanical security of stiff boards while offering the layout versatility of flexible circuits, therefore enabling the development of very advanced digital systems.

RF PCBs, or radio frequency printed circuit card, are created to handle high-frequency signals in wireless communication devices. These boards are necessary in applications such as cellphones, radar systems, and satellite interactions. RF PCBs require specialized materials and design methods to ensure they can handle the high-frequency signals without considerable signal loss or disturbance. The exact layout and production procedures involved in producing RF PCBs make them important parts in the growth of sophisticated cordless modern technologies.
